Yumei Wang is a scholar working on Plant Science, Molecular Biology and Genetics. According to data from OpenAlex, Yumei Wang has authored 50 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 37 papers in Plant Science, 10 papers in Molecular Biology and 7 papers in Genetics. Recurrent topics in Yumei Wang's work include Research in Cotton Cultivation (23 papers), Genetic Mapping and Diversity in Plants and Animals (7 papers) and Plant Molecular Biology Research (6 papers). Yumei Wang is often cited by papers focused on Research in Cotton Cultivation (23 papers), Genetic Mapping and Diversity in Plants and Animals (7 papers) and Plant Molecular Biology Research (6 papers). Yumei Wang collaborates with scholars based in China, United States and Australia. Yumei Wang's co-authors include Chih‐Ching Teng, Zengwei Yuan, Tang Ya, Jinping Hua, Jinping Hua, Yanpeng Zhao, Ying Su, Yi Huang, Lianguang Shang and Mengyao Li and has published in prestigious journals such as PLoS ONE, Bioresource Technology and Scientific Reports.
